Stiffness in the fingers and difficulty making a fist after cutting around them with a dog leash may be due to soft tissue injury, swelling, or inflammation resulting from the trauma. If sutures were involved, there could also be scarring or tension around the healing tissue, contributing to the stiffness. Additionally, any nerve irritation or damage from the injury could affect finger mobility. It's important to consult a healthcare professional for an accurate diagnosis and appropriate treatment.

How do you wistle with your fingers?

To whistle with your fingers, place your fingers (usually your index and middle fingers) in your mouth with your fingertips against your tongue. Seal your lips around your fingers and blow air out forcefully to create a sound. Adjust the position and tightness of your lips and the angle of your fingers until you produce a clear whistle.


What are knots in your back?

Knots are muscles that are spasmed or contracted relative to the muscle around them. They tend to be localized and can cause pain and stiffness.
